Code is more coherent than configuration: comparing a sample blog in Web Origami and Eleventy
Read OriginalThis article is a technical deep dive comparing the architectural approaches of Web Origami and Eleventy static site generators. It analyzes how each tool structures a sample blog project, contrasting Eleventy's configuration-heavy, file-system-based model with Origami's code-centric, explicit definition of site resources. The piece is aimed at developers evaluating static site generators and discusses concepts like project coherence and maintainability.
